We are seeking a dedicated Procedure Nurse to join our client's dermatology clinic in Lancashire. The role involves supporting clinicians with biopsies and excisions, ensuring high standards of patient care and clinical safety.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Assisting with minor surgical procedures, maintaining a sterile environment, and providing both pre- and post-procedure patient support.
  • Assisting with biopsies and excisions, ensuring safety, precision, and patient comfort.
  • Maintaining infection control standards and preparing equipment for procedures.
  • Providing patient care before, during, and after procedures, including aftercare guidance.
  • Accurately documenting patient notes and procedural outcomes.

Essential Criteria:

  • Registered Nurse (NMC) qualification.
  • Experience supporting dermatology procedures, particularly biopsies and excisions.
  • Knowledge of infection control, clinical governance, and patient confidentiality.
